During last week's investigation into missing spans between gateway-edge and the Permafrost billing workers, we found that three of the five Lattice microservices are running stale tracing settings. The sampler rate, propagation headers, and collector endpoint differ between what Ansible renders and what the pods actually load, likely due to a manual hotfix applied during the Brindlewood incident. Spans are silently dropped at service boundaries. For reference, here is the tracing configuration currently live in production.

deployment values, bahof-badug:
[rusix]
team = zorok
access_code = ac_641cbe
owner = ulair.tamius
host = rusix.torvasoft.local
port = 5672
peer = ulaix.sivrelworks.internal
salt = 1df570ed
pin = 6327

## Transporting Paper Ledgers to the Archive

When preparing ledgers from the Hollowmere site for long-term storage at the Draycott Archive, wrap each volume individually in acid-free paper and pack no more than six per crate. Seal crates with tamper-evident tape and record the seal numbers in the transfer log before release. Crates must travel upright and remain attended at all times. The confidential courier hand-over instruction follows below.

dispatch memo: the quenax olidor courier leaves the lamvan aldath keliel ledger at gate 2085 under passcode 005795

## Deploying the Gatewick Proctor Queue

Deploys are pretty painless: push to main, wait for the pipeline, then watch the queue drain dashboard for five minutes. If candidates pile up mid-exam, roll back first and ask questions later — the queue replays safely. Everything the workers care about lives in one config block, shown here for reference.

settings of bafof-yagef:
JOROX_PIN=8740
JOROX_TENANT=pelox
JOROX_METRICS_HOST=metrics.jorox.qorvelworks.internal
JOROX_SEAL=seal_c78f63c1
JOROX_STANDBY_TEAM=norax